Some versions can be removed from the Add/Remove Programs option in the Control Panel. This option seems to be missing in the newer Net2Phone version. Try this:
Exit Bargain Buddy from your Tray Bar, if it is present.
Press CTRL + ALT + DEL to remove Bargain Buddy from your task manager (if it is present).
Proceed to Start -> Control Panel -> Add / Remove Programs, and remove Bargain Buddy.
If the uninstall for Bargain Buddy isn't present in the Add / Remove Programs Window, the Uninstaller may be listed in your Program Files (accessible from the Start Menu).
To remove it manually:
1) Unregister the DLL file first.
In BargainBuddy/Apuc, this DLL is inside the Bargain Buddy folder in 'Program Files'. Here there will be one or more 'bin' folders, one of which will contain a file called apuc.dll. If, for example, it's in 'bin2', the commands to enter (from a DOS command prompt window, under Start->Programs->Accessories) would be:
cd "%WinDir%\System"
regsvr32 /u "\Program Files\Bargain Buddy\bin2\apuc.dll"
Note:%WinDir% is a variable, you should replace it with the windows directory on your system, by default, it is named c:\windows or c:\winnt .
In BargainBuddy/Version, the file you have to get rid of is instead called 'CC_Versn.dll', and it's inside the 'Net2Phone CommCenter' folder in Program Files. The commands to get rid of it are:
cd "%WinDir%\System"
regsvr32 /u "\Program Files\Net2Phone CommCenter\CC_Versn.dll".
2) Open Task Manager (ctrl-alt-delete), end the 'Bargains' process.
3) Delete the entire 'Bargain Buddy' folder.
4) Run the registry editor(Click Start > Run and type ' Regedit').
5) Locate and expand the key H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run, find and delete the Bargain Buddy entry.
6) Find and delete the key H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Bargains; in the Adp variant this is H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\adp instead.
